  What is a Wallet Hack Bitcoin?

  A wallet hack Bitcoin refers to the unauthorized access and theft of Bitcoin from a user's digital wallet. These wallets can be either software-based, such as mobile or desktop applications, or hardware-based, like USB devices. Cybercriminals exploit vulnerabilities in these wallets to gain access to private keys, which are essential for authorizing transactions and accessing the Bitcoin stored within.

  Methods Used in Wallet Hack Bitcoin

  1. Phishing Attacks: One of the most common methods used in wallet hack Bitcoin is phishing. Cybercriminals create fake websites or emails that mimic legitimate Bitcoin wallet services. Unsuspecting users are tricked into entering their login credentials, which are then stolen by the attacker.

  2. Malware: Malware, such as viruses, worms, and trojans, can be used to infect a user's device and gain access to their Bitcoin wallet. Once the malware is installed, it can monitor keystrokes, steal private keys, and even encrypt the user's data for ransom.

  3. Social Engineering: Cybercriminals may also use social engineering techniques to manipulate individuals into revealing their private keys or other sensitive information. This can include impersonating a trusted authority figure or creating a sense of urgency to prompt the user to act without thinking.

  4. Brute Force Attacks: In some cases, cybercriminals may attempt to crack a user's private key through brute force, which involves trying every possible combination of characters until the correct one is found.

  Protecting Your Bitcoin Wallet

  1. Use Secure Wallets: Opt for reputable Bitcoin wallets that offer robust security features, such as two-factor authentication, biometric verification, and encryption. Hardware wallets are generally considered the safest option, as they store private keys offline.

  2. Be Wary of Phishing Attempts: Always verify the legitimacy of websites and emails before providing any personal information. Look for signs of phishing, such as misspellings, grammatical errors, and suspicious URLs.

  3. Keep Your Software Updated: Regularly update your Bitcoin wallet software and operating system to patch vulnerabilities and protect against malware.

  4. Use Strong Passwords: Create strong, unique passwords for your Bitcoin wallet and avoid using the same password for multiple accounts.

  5. Enable Multi-Factor Authentication: Where possible, enable multi-factor authentication to add an extra layer of security to your wallet.

  6. Be Skeptical of Social Engineering: Be cautious of unsolicited requests for personal information or private keys. Never share your private keys with anyone, including friends, family, or even wallet support staff.
